I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Administration système Discussion :

Modif de menu.lst (GRUB) après recompil du kernel


Sujet :

Administration système

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    HNT
    HNT est déconnecté
    Membre éclairé Avatar de HNT
    Profil pro
    Étudiant
    Inscrit en
    Juin 2005
    Messages
    448
    Détails du profil
    Informations personnelles :
    Âge : 37
    Localisation : Belgique

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Juin 2005
    Messages : 448
    Par défaut Modif de menu.lst (GRUB) après recompil du kernel
    Bonjour,

    Je viens recemment de passer de Suse à Debian et je voudrais recompiler mon kernel (car avec la 3.1 on a un 2.4.27), je suis donc la procédure suivante :
    en root,
    make xconfig
    make
    make modules_install && make install
    Lors du xconfig je laisse les paramètres par défaut.

    puis je veut éditer le fichier menu.lst et là je rencontre des pb :
    Je me base sur les autres champs disponibles pour crée mon entrée mais ça foire car à chaque démarrage il me lache l'erreur :
    VFS : Cannot open root device "hde2" or unknown block(0,0)
    Please append a correct "root=" boot option
    Kernel panic-not syncing : VFS : Unable to mount root fs on unknown block (0,0)
    Voila je me doute bien que j'ai un pb dans mon menu.lst, le voici :
    #debut mon entree
    title Debian GNU/linux kernel 2.6.15.6-686
    root(hd0)
    kernel /boot/vmlinuz-2.6.15.6 root=/dev/hde2 ro
    #fin mon entree

    title Debian GNU/Linux, kernel 2.4.27-2-386
    root (hd0,1)
    kernel /boot/vmlinuz-2.4.27-2-386 root=/dev/hde2 ro
    initrd /boot/initrd.img-2.4.27-2-386

    title Debian GNU/Linux, kernel 2.4.27-2-386 (recovery mode)
    root (hd0,1)
    kernel /boot/vmlinuz-2.4.27-2-386 root=/dev/hde2 ro single
    initrd /boot/initrd.img-2.4.27-2-386
    Bon déjà je ne sais pas quoi mettre comme initrd parce que il n'y as pas de fichier initrd2.6.15.6 dans le /boot les seuls fichiers portant 2.6.15.6 dans une partie de leurs noms sont les suivants :
    System.map
    vmlinuz
    config

    Voila, si quelqu'un sait m'aider ce serait bien sympa.

  2. #2
    Membre Expert
    Avatar de narmataru
    Profil pro
    Inscrit en
    Décembre 2002
    Messages
    1 548
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ations forums :
    Inscription : Décembre 2002
    Messages : 1 548
    Par défaut
    la procédure sous débian lorsque tu comile un noyau te génère un .deb normalement (fais des recherche avec les mots clef "compiler un noyau à la sauce debian"). Tu installe le nouveau noyau avec la commande "dpkg -i linux_image-vers-monnoyau.deb" et ça met automatiquement ton grub à jour.

Discussions similaires

  1. Grub et le fichier menu.lst
    Par IAGISG dans le forum Administration système
    Réponses: 2
    Dernier message: 09/02/2011, 20h37
  2. Grub et le fichier menu.lst
    Par aitina dans le forum Debian
    Réponses: 3
    Dernier message: 24/04/2008, 15h43
  3. [débutant] /boot/grub/menu.lst~ est en lecture seule
    Par paterson dans le forum Administration système
    Réponses: 2
    Dernier message: 08/07/2007, 19h32
  4. Réponses: 2
    Dernier message: 09/05/2003, 17h41
  5. [VB6] modification de menu
    Par rikko23 dans le forum VB 6 et antérieur
    Réponses: 5
    Dernier message: 27/11/2002, 21h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o